The Experience Itself: What You’ll Be Visiting

Location and Setting

The experience is set at Asiatique The Riverfront, a lively spot that combines shopping, dining, and entertainment. The address is 2194 Chareonkrung Road, and it’s conveniently near public transportation, making it easy to access without hassle. The surroundings outside the exhibit are often noted for their stunning views, especially the riverside backdrop which adds to the overall atmosphere.

The Core Attraction: Jurassic World: The Experience

Once inside, you’ll encounter life-sized, hyper-realistic animatronic dinosaurs placed in scenes reminiscent of the movies. The exhibit covers over 6,000 sq.m., and the attention to detail is notable, with some reviews highlighting the excellent photo opportunities and the ability to take shots that feel like you’ve stepped into the film.

The Predator Pavilion and Observation Deck are among the key areas, crafted to give visitors a sense of being in the middle of the dinosaur world. The 5-star-rated experience is praised for its visual realism and the way it captures the excitement of the franchise.

Practical Details: Timing, Transportation, and Comfort

Duration

The core experience lasts about 60 minutes, but you should plan for additional time if you’re accessing other parts of Asiatique or booking dinner cruises. The flexibility in options means you can extend your visit or enjoy a relaxed meal afterward.

Hours of Operation

The exhibit is open daily from 11 AM to 10 PM, with the last entry at 9 PM. This generous schedule allows for daytime visits or evening outings, especially if you combine with dinner cruises.

Transportation

Most options include pickup or private transfer, which simplifies travel, especially if you’re unfamiliar with Bangkok’s transit system. The location near public transportation makes it accessible whether you’re coming from a hotel or other attractions.
